Kang Cao is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Economics and Econometrics and Geophysics. According to data from OpenAlex, Kang Cao has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 695 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 10 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 9 papers in Geophysics. Recurrent topics in Kang Cao’s work include Electric Power System Optimization (10 papers), Geological and Geochemical Analysis (9 papers) and Smart Grid Energy Management (6 papers). Kang Cao is often cited by papers focused on Electric Power System Optimization (10 papers), Geological and Geochemical Analysis (9 papers) and Smart Grid Energy Management (6 papers). Kang Cao coll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Kang Cao's co-authors include Javier A. Birchenall, John Baker, Zhiming Yang, C.K. Woo, Noel C. White, Liu Yun, Qiqi Li, Jifeng Xu, Wentao Hao and Yongjia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Cleaner Production, Applied Energy and Chemical Physics Letters.
